We are looking for:
- A number of M&A Manager(s) to reinforce the M&A team of Syensqo. The M&A Manager will report to the Head of M&A who reports to the Chief Strategy Officer.
We count on you for:
- The M&A Manager will be in charge of acquisition, divestment and joint-venture projects from project launch until signing and closing of the transaction(s)
- Business modeling and financial evaluation of companies in the context of mergers, acquisitions, divestment and joint-venture projects
- Overall coordination of the project team throughout the project lifecycle (set up of the team and the overall timeline, team animation and team monitoring)
- Preparation, supervision and review of the various internal and external deliverables (Teaser, Information Memorandum, Business Plan, Deal Structuring Plan, Carve-Out Matters, VDD, Virtual Data Room preparation and review, review of SPA and Ancillary Agreements…)
- Identification and coordination of the external advisors (investment banks, M&A boutiques, strategy consultants, transaction services consultants, tax advisors…)
- Coordination of all internal stakeholders throughout the project: business teams, finance teams and representatives of the various corporate functions and shared services centers of the Group (tax, treasury, accounting, environmental…)
- Close collaboration with the M&A, Antitrust and Trademark Corporate Counsel and his team on all legal aspects of the transaction (due diligence, negotiation, contractual aspects, closing process...). The M&A Manager will participate in the entire negotiation process for the transaction(s) under his (her) responsibility
- Presentation of recommendations to the senior management of the Group
